Estimating Waste Volume



To precisely select the right size Skip bin for your task, you have to first estimate the quantity of waste you'll be throwing away. One way to do this is by aesthetically inspecting the things you plan to discard and about approximating their complete volume in cubic meters.

Additionally, you can make use of online tools or waste quantity calculators to help you figure out the approximate quantity of waste you'll have. Remember that it's better to a little overstate than to ignore, as it's more economical to employ a somewhat larger Skip container than to purchase an additional one if you run out of area.



If you're still not sure, think about consulting from waste management professionals that can provide assistance based upon the sort of job you're taking on. By precisely estimating your waste quantity, you'll be much better outfitted to pick the appropriate Skip bin size for your needs.

Comprehending Bin Dimensions



Comprehending bin measurements is critical when selecting the suitable Skip bin size for your project. Skip containers been available in different measurements, generally determined in cubic meters.

The measurements of a skip bin refer to its size, width, and elevation. By comprehending these measurements, you can picture how much waste the container can hold and whether it will certainly suit your requirements.

For instance, a 2 cubic meter Skip bin may have measurements of roughly 1.8 meters in size, 1.4 meters in size, and 0.9 meters in height. Recognizing these dimensions can help you identify if the Skip bin will certainly suit your preferred area and if it can fit the volume of waste you anticipate producing.

Constantly take into consideration the space you have available for the Skip container and make certain that its dimensions line up with your project needs to stay clear of any concerns during waste disposal.
